Support for automaticaly packaging the data from the demo and full versions into a proper .deb has been recently added to game-data-packager; see git master: http://anonscm.debian.org/cgit/pkg-games/game-data-packager.git/tree/data/theme-hospital.yaml This will someday trickle down to unstable & then Ubuntu. You can already add a "Depends: theme-hospital-full-data | theme-hospital-demo-data | game-data-packager" control rule to your package to make your users life easier.
